Understanding the SAP Cloud ALM Certification
What Makes This Certification Different?
Here's the deal:
This isn't your typical SAP certification. The C_STC exam uses a NEW FORMAT that tests real-world scenarios, not just theoretical knowledge.
Key Certification Details:
- Role: Solution Transformation Consultant
- Exam Format: Scenario-based assessment (1 activity)
- Time Limit: 24 hours to complete
- Passing Score: 50% cut score
- Validity: 12 months (renewable with reassessment)
What You'll Master:
✅ Product Lifecycle Management
✅ Solution Architecture
✅ Software Deployment
✅ Development & Testing Methodologies
✅ Software Testing Life Cycle

The Complete 35-Hour Learning Journey Breakdown
Here's what makes this certification achievable:
SAP provides a FREE learning journey called "Transforming for Success with SAP Cloud ALM" that covers everything you need.
Your 5-Course Study Roadmap
Course 1: Navigating RISE Transformations (2 hours)
Course Code: BTM004
You'll understand how SAP LeanIX, Signavio, and Cloud ALM work together through a 3-sprint case study.
Key Units:
- Understanding the Integrated Toolchain
- Supporting RISE with SAP Transformations
- From Discovery to Implementation
Course 2: Introducing SAP Cloud ALM (4 hours)
Course Code: CALM01
Want to know the best part?
This course teaches you how Cloud ALM reduces costs and accelerates time-to-market.
What You'll Learn:
- Benefits for implementation and operations
- Value proposition for your projects
- Innovation in service delivery
- Transition planning from Solution Manager
Course 3: Onboarding, Setup & Administration (2 hours)
Course Code: CALM05
Now:
You'll get hands-on with the actual system setup.
Critical Skills:
- Requesting SAP Cloud ALM access
- User onboarding and role assignments
- Integration and configuration options
Course 4: Implementing with SAP Cloud ALM (10 hours)
Course Code: CALM20
This is the heavy hitter.
Deep Dive Topics:
- Project and team setup
- Requirements management
- Deployment management
- Testing execution
- Analytics and reporting
- Tool readiness checks
Pro tip: This course connects directly to SAP Activate methodology - critical exam material.
Course 5: RISE Transformation Execution (1 hour)
Course Code: CALM61
Here's the kicker:
You'll master the RISE with SAP Methodology and learn how Cloud ALM supports Clean Core across five dimensions:
- Processes
- Data
- Integration
- Extensions
- Operations
Plus: You'll discover the RISE Methodology Dashboard - a game-changer for tracking transformation success.

5. Focus on Clean Core Principles
Want to know what examiners love testing?
Clean Core's five dimensions:
|
Dimension |
Key Concepts |
|
Processes |
Standard vs. custom processes, BPM adoption |
|
Data |
Data quality, master data governance |
|
Integration |
APIs, standard integration patterns |
|
Extensions |
Side-by-side extensibility, avoiding core modifications |
|
Operations |
Monitoring, incident management, analytics |

Common Mistakes to Avoid
❌ Mistake #1: Skipping Hands-On Practice
The problem: You can memorize concepts but fail practical scenarios.
The solution: Spend at least 10 hours in the actual Cloud ALM system.
❌ Mistake #2: Ignoring the RISE Connection
Many candidates focus only on Cloud ALM and forget the RISE with SAP context.
Remember: This certification is about transformation consulting, not just tool expertise.
❌ Mistake #3: Rushing Through Course 4
Course 4 (Implementing with SAP Cloud ALM) is 10 hours for a reason.
Pro tip: Spend 2-3 weeks on this course, practicing each concept as you learn it.
❌ Mistake #4: Not Understanding Analytics
The exam tests your ability to use Cloud ALM Analytics for decision-making.
Study: Dashboards, KPIs, reporting capabilities, and data-driven insights.
❌ Mistake #5: Neglecting Deployment Management
Deployment Management is a critical exam topic.
Focus on:
- Change and deployment strategy
- Transport management
- Release planning
- Go-live preparation
